Discover 11 acres of beautiful vistas - the culmination of a lifetime of passion for gardening. Sweeping herbaceous borders, historic walled garden, the Grade I listed house as a backdrop … then, of course, the plants! Flower beds overflowing with perennials and annuals – the look changing through the seasons, but always abundantly filled. Open April to September; Special Events; Tulip Festival; Café with garden views; Sculpture/Art Exhibitions; Gift Shop.

Many thanks for your enquiry - I am afraid dogs, except trained assistance dogs, are not allowed in the gardens here (we have a swan and ducks and moorhens etc.)
No, I wouldn't say it is wheelchair user friendly. There are steps, woodlands, gravel paths etc, so I feel it would be very difficult to push a wheelchair around. Hope this helps
